In Devens, we frequently address issues related to the harsh New England winters, including premature brake corrosion, battery failures due to cold starts, and suspension wear from potholes on roads like Jackson Road and Barnum Road. For Chevrolet models like the Equinox and Silverado, this often translates into specific repairs for wheel bearings, starter motors, and control arms.
Look for a shop that is ASE-certified and has specific GM/Chevrolet diagnostic tooling, such as a Tech 2 or GDS2 scanner. In the Devens region, checking for strong reviews from local business parks or nearby communities like Ayer and Shirley can also indicate reliable service for your Chevy's complex electronic systems.
Seek service imm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that can damage the catalytic converter, especially during stop-and-go traffic on routes like Route 2. A steady light still warrants a prompt diagnostic scan, as it could be an emissions or sensor issue that could worsen and fail a Massachusetts state inspection.
Typically, yes, dealerships have higher labor rates, but for complex computer or warranty-related work, their specialized expertise can be necessary. For most routine repairs and maintenance, a qualified independent shop in the Devens area can provide OEM or high-quality parts at a more competitive price, saving you money without sacrificing quality.
The significant temperature swings and road salt used in winter necessitate more frequent undercarriage washes to prevent rust and more vigilant attention to your coolant mixture and battery health. Given Devens' mix of highway and rural driving, following the "Severe Service" schedule in your Chevy's manual for oil changes and fluid checks is highly recommended.
